Developer / company: RITLabs

BatPost! is a mail server software for all kinds of companies. Server software fits the requirement to provide company employees both with Internet addresses and internal mail and/or message network traffic.
BatPost mail server runs under Windows NT, Windows 2000, Windows XP and Windows 2003.

You will appreciate:

  • fast and simple server installation,
  • ease of use,
  • simple maintenance,
  • modest use of system resources,
  • great security.
